python+vue垃圾分类论坛的设计与实现85l30

news2024/9/28 15:22:05

环境保护是一项利国利民的重大民生工程,是造福子孙后代的幸福事,基于全面分析我国大学生环境保护教育现状的基础上提出了高校可通过开设环境类通识任选课、专业课中融入环境保护教育、环境保护实践教学、环境保护第二课堂等有效途径加强对非环境类专业大学生环境保护教育。
本系统就以垃圾分类论坛的设计与实现来对整个系统的描术,主要以:垃圾信息、垃圾图谱、活动信息、学习视频、垃圾分类论坛交流、试卷等。所以,经过分析,使用python的语言来开发本垃圾分类论坛。Pycharm语言具有开发软件的特性,其优点是安全性能高,能减轻用户端浏览器的负担,提高交互速度。系统拟选用的python开发平台先结合 Pycharm服务器开发更加的简单和便捷,其快捷方便的代码编辑界面,友好的代码提示,以及智能高效的代码调试,让整个开发过程更高效;采用的数据库为MySQL。
开发垃圾分类论坛的设计与实现来代替传统的纸质垃圾分类提交方式,实现在线垃圾分类论坛的网络化管理。
在对系统进行功能需求分析,首先要了解系统的使用场合和使用人群。本系统是针对现垃圾分类中的问题而开发的一套垃圾分类论坛的设计与实现。基于Web的形式完成对管理。本系统分为两个权限:系统管理员、用户。
(1)    系统管理员的功能:
管理员登录功能、管理员更改密码、管理员查看整个系统的模块、管理员对用户进行新增、删除。
(2)    用户的功能:
用户通过注册页面注册、登录修改个人信息。
(3)    垃圾信息的功能:
对垃圾信息进行查看评论、收藏。
(4)活动信息的功能:
用户登录后通过活动信息页面进行报名提交。
(5)学习视频的功能:
通过视频页面认识垃圾的分类的常识。
(6)论坛交流的功能:
用户通过论坛进行帖子发布,可选择公开或私人,评论其他用户帖子,后台管理员进行维护
(7)试卷的功能:
用户通过试卷列表查看试卷名称、考试时长、创建时间。
(8)在线客服的功能:
用户通过在线客服向管理员提问,管理员进行回复用户。
(9)系统管理
管理员通过系统管理管理在线客服、轮播图,以及对整个系统进行维护等操作


目  录
1 绪论    1
1.1引言    1
1.2课题研究目    1
1.3开发现状分析    2
1.4课题开发意义    2
2 开发环境介绍    4
2.1 Python简介    4
2.2  Dango框架介绍    5
2.3 MySQL数据库    6
3 系统分析    11
3.1需求分析    11
3.1.1设计目标    11
3.1.2用户需求分析    11
3.1.3系统功能需求分析    11
3.2功能分析    12
4 系统设计    14
4.1系统总体设计    15
4.2功能设计    16
4.3数据库设计    17
5 系统实现
5.1系统的主要文件组成    18
5.2管理员模块    19
5.3前台功能模块    20
5.4用户后台功能模块    21
6 系统测试    22
6.1测试流程    23
6.2测试结果    24
7 总结与展望    25
参 考 文 献    26
致  谢    27

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/571106.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

拥挤聚集智能监测算法

拥挤聚集智能监测算法可以通过yolov7网络模型深度学习框架对人员数量、密度等进行实时监测,拥挤聚集智能监算法识别出拥挤聚集的情况,并及时发出预警。YOLOv7 的发展方向与当前主流的实时目标检测器不同,它能够同时支持移动 GPU 和从边缘到云…

开源日志监控采集平台ELKF

---------------------- FilebeatELK 部署 ---------------------- Node1节点(2C/4G):node1/192.168.179.20 Elasticsearch Node2节点(2C/4G):node2/192.168.179.23 …

All in ECP,转转一站式ES数据清洗解决方案

1. 业务背景 转转作为国内头部的循环经济产业公司,目前业务架构是中台模式。中台负责提供通用的交易能力,灵活快速响应业务需求,业务方负责前台探索创新,为用户提供有价值的服务。 转转交易中台目前分为基础服务、订单、促销、天路…

《深度思维》跨越式*

参考: https://www.zhihu.com/tardis/zm/art/410244111?source_id1005 从思维的技术到思维的格局,再到专注努力与漫长人生中坚忍的精神图腾,作者通过方法理论与案例相结合,介绍了深度思思维的学习方法。 深度思维简介 拥有较长的…

手机一开,说办就办!指尖上的“数字江西”

数字江西科技有限公司(下简称“数字江西”)是经省委省政府同意,由江西省信息中心(大数据中心)管理的国有控股合资公司,于2020年3月2日成立,是江西省人民政府的重要实践,也是江西省委…

opencv_c++学习(二十三)

一、点拟合操作 拟合含义如上图,即为通过已知点去拟合一条直线或者一个多边形。 直线拟合函数: fitLine(lnputArray points, OutputArray line, int distType, double param, double reps, double aeps)points:输入待拟合直线的2D或者3D点集。 line:输…

【2023 · CANN训练营第一季】MindSpore模型快速调优攻略 第二章——MindSpore调试调优

1.生态迁移 生态迁移工具使用示例 生态迁移工具技术方案 不同框架间模型定义前端表达差别巨大(相同算子的API技术难点 、 算子功能、模型构建方式差别较大); 对于同一框架,不管前端表达差异如何,最终对应的计算 图是相似的。因此提出&#x…

node.js+vue房屋租赁管理系统z0g8w

本系统主要包括以下功能模块:租户、出租人、房源信息、预约看房、合同信息等模块。 其中设计的主要功能如下: (1)用户的注册和登录本系统,登录到系统的首页。 (2)用户可以发布自己的房源信息…

快速了解iptables

初识 iptables是什么? iptables是一个在Linux操作系统上使用的防火墙工具,它可以用于配置和管理网络数据包的过滤、转发和修改等操作。 过滤数据包:iptables可以根据不同的规则过滤网络数据包,例如根据源IP地址、目标IP地址、端…

如何在华为OD机试中获得满分?Java实现【不含101的数】一文详解!

✅创作者:陈书予 🎉个人主页:陈书予的个人主页 🍁陈书予的个人社区,欢迎你的加入: 陈书予的社区 🌟专栏地址: Java华为OD机试真题(2022&2023) 文章目录 1. 题目描述2. 输入描述3. 输出描述…

开源开放 生态共建 | openKylin社区单位会员突破200家!

当前,开放、协作、共享的开源模式已成为全球软件技术和产业创新的主导,也为信息技术国产自主化提供了强大助力。openKylin作为中国桌面操作系统开源社区,以聚焦桌面操作系统根技术为核心、以孵化相关领域关键项目为目标、以布道开源文化为抓手…

堪称「史上最详细」的整车信息安全强标将发布!释放了哪些信号?

确保汽车整车信息安全,或成为车企们继智能化竞争的下一个竞争焦点。 可以说,在智能化、网联化的驱动下,智能汽车成为了数据收集、数据传输、数据处理的关键节点,消费者在享受汽车智能化带来便利的同时,也逐渐重视智能…

【操作系统复习】第8章 文件管理

数据项、记录和文件 数据项 ➢ 基本数据项:描述一个对象的某种属性,又称字段 ➢ 组合数据项:由若干个基本数据项组成记录 ➢ 记录是一组相关数据项的集合,用于描述一个对象在某方面的属性。 ➢ 关键字:唯一能…

04_GC垃圾回收

面试题: JVM内存模型以及分区,需要详细到每个区放什么 堆里面的分区:Eden,survival from to,老年代,各自的特点。 GC的三种收集方法:标记清除、标记整理、复制算法的原理与特点,分…

python+vue高校网上跳蚤二手市场的设计与实现

商品信息是卖家供应用户必不可少的一个部分。在跳蚤市场发展的整个过程中,商品担负着最重要的角色。为满足如今日益复杂的管理需求,各类管理系统程序也在不断改进。本课题所设计的普通高校网上跳蚤市场,使用Django框架,Python语言…

【2023年电工杯数学建模竞赛】选题分析+A题B题完整思路+代码分享

思路和代码会第一时间分享出来,可以先关注博主 1.竞赛介绍 2.本次大赛选题分析 首先大家要清楚获奖只和比例有关,和具体题目关系不大,不会出现选难题就比简单题获奖率高很多的情况出现,这是一个选拔性质的比赛是按照比例来的 2…

(5.19-5.25)【大数据新闻速递】

关 注gzh“大数据食铁兽”,了解更多大数据快讯 【第八届亚太银行数字化创新峰会圆满落幕】 第八届亚太银行数字化创新峰会在2023年5月18日举行,邀请了30名大咖和超过300位行业顶尖人士参加。金融数据港和中银协中西部培训机构提供特别支持。峰会围绕银行…

Kafka实时数据即席查询应用与实践

作者:vivo 互联网搜索团队- Deng Jie Kafka中的实时数据是以Topic的概念进行分类存储,而Topic的数据是有一定时效性的,比如保存24小时、36小时、48小时等。而在定位一些实时数据的Case时,如果没有对实时数据进行历史归档&#xff…

list的基本介绍

list的基本信息: list是一个带头双向链表的结构。constant,常数、常量,constant time 即O(1)时间复杂度。 先来简单认识一下list list支持尾插,尾删,头插,头删 都是一些已知的内容。 和vector的区别就是支…

Java货运物流园管理系统源码

技术架构:spring boot、mybatis、redis、vue、element-ui 开发语言:java、vue、uniapp 开发工具:idea、vscode、hbuilder 前端框架:vue 后端框架:spring boot 数 据 库:mysql 移 动 端: …